Meghan Markle's Acting Career: The Foundation of Her Wealth
Suits: Meghan's Breakout Role
Meghan's big break came in 2011 when she landed the role of Rachel Zane in the legal drama series Suits. The show was a massive hit, and Meghan's portrayal of Rachel catapulted her to fame. As the series progressed, so did her paycheck. By 2017, Meghan Markle's salary per episode was estimated to be around $50,000.
Other Acting Gigs
Before Suits, Meghan had a few minor roles in TV shows and movies. Some of these include General Hospital, CSI: NY, and the romantic comedy Remember Me. While these roles didn't bring in as much money as Suits, they helped Meghan gain valuable experience and build her resume.
Meghan's Lifestyle Blog: The Tig
In 2014, Meghan launched her lifestyle blog, The Tig. The blog was a passion project where Meghan shared her interests in fashion, food, travel, and social issues. While Meghan never revealed the exact earnings from The Tig, it's estimated that she made a six-figure income from the blog through sponsored posts, advertising, and affiliate marketing.
Meghan Markle's Net Worth in 2017
So, how much was Meghan Markle worth in 2017? Meghan Markle's net worth in 2017 was estimated to be around $7 million. Here's a breakdown of how she accumulated this wealth:
- Acting Career: Meghan's primary source of income was her acting career. By 2017, she had starred in 108 episodes of Suits, earning her an estimated $5.5 million. - The Tig: While Meghan didn't disclose the exact earnings from her blog, it's estimated that she made around $800,000 from The Tig. - Endorsements and Sponsorships: Meghan had endorsement deals with brands like Reitmans, Rimmel, and Canadian clothing company Joe Fresh. These deals added to her net worth, although the exact amounts were not disclosed.
